[[gablel windows|Gable windows]] are [[operating windows|operating windows]] which are installed in the exterior wall between the edges of a sloping gable roof. Gable windows generally include [[casement windows|casement windows]] or [[single hung windows|single]] or [[double hung windows|double]] hung windows though [[horizontal sliding windows|gliders]] may also be installed in specific situations. A gable window compliments a gable roof's structural system. The shape of a replacement gable window is determined by the type of roof that covers the window. A gable window blends into the design of a gable roof to ensure that the structure presents a unified architectural design while allowing more light and ventilation into the room below the gable roof.
